When applying for my FAC, I originally put down 7.62/.308. I was told it had to be one or the other (d'oh!) so chose 7.62. So I could get a x39, x51 or x54R. Strangely, I can buy 7.62 and .308 ammo, even though when I get my 7.62x51 I won't be shooting .308 ammo out of it!

by Sandgroper
It seems BASC has slightly changed the wording of it's advice, as I remember it.
http://www.basc.org.uk/en/utilities/doc ... 6DEB7A38C2
It now reads
Calibre. The question asks for the calibre of rifle/pistol/shotgun, not for the name of
the cartridge. For example .308 & .223 rather than .308 Winchester or .223 Remington.
However due to the complexity of ammunition development, it is advisable to list the
specific cartridge designation e.g. .17HMR or .17 Remington as the difference in
performance between these two examples differ greatly, one is rimfire and the other is
centrefire. The police need to deal with the application with regard to the specific
ballistics of the cartridge e.g. for land checks and to ensure that what is applied for is
appropriate and in some cases conform to secondary legislation i.e. the ballistic
requirements contained within the Deer Act.
Advisable but not necessary. In any case it is still worth a try.
